We've all experienced it. Your house party is in full swing, your playlist accruing a smattering of compliments, when a rogue film soundtrack sneaks into the mix. As you scramble to unplug your iPod, the Imperial March kills the atmosphere quicker than a force choke.

That's not to say there isn't a time and a place for a movie soundtracks - we'd have a pretty extensive collection if the cover artwork was designed by Simon Delart. The Parisian designer has reworked icons from of some of the greatest film scores ever recorded with a triangle-filled low poly effect to create a series of gorgeous vinyl covers.

The sleeves included entries for Star Wars, Jurassic Park and the *VVWWWAAAAARRNNNPPP*-heavy Inception. Plug yourself in to your favourite soundtrack and take a look through our favourites. You can see more of Delart's work over on his Behance page.
